A cold is a disease that causes inflammation of the mucous membranes of the throat and nose. The main symptoms are fever, runny nose, cough, and lethargy. Small children are especially vulnerable to various infections, but some parents are negligent about respiratory diseases, considering them to be something common. How to treat colds in babies?
